Oilfield projects are complex by nature. From drilling and completion operations to production support and maintenance activities, each stage depends on accurate planning, qualified suppliers, reliable equipment, and timely field coordination. Polaris provides integrated oilfield project support to help clients manage these moving parts more effectively.

One of the most important challenges in oilfield project execution is aligning technical requirements with available supply and service resources. Polaris helps clients clarify specifications, identify suitable equipment categories, and communicate requirements to qualified manufacturers, suppliers, and specialist contractors. This early-stage support helps reduce misunderstandings and improves the efficiency of later procurement and execution work.

For EPC contractors and oilfield service companies, procurement coordination can directly affect project progress. Equipment, spare parts, and technical components often need to meet strict operational requirements while also being delivered according to site schedules. Polaris supports equipment and spares coordination by assisting with supplier communication, order follow-up, technical clarification, and delivery planning.

Inspection and quality documentation are also central to oilfield project control. Polaris helps coordinate inspection activities and manage related documentation, including quality files, technical records, packing documents, and other project-required materials. Proper documentation helps ensure that equipment can be reviewed, accepted, shipped, and delivered with fewer delays.

Logistics is another area where execution-focused support adds value. Oilfield equipment often involves cross-border transportation, customs procedures, site delivery requirements, and coordination between international and local teams. Polaris helps arrange import-export logistics and site delivery, supporting a smoother transition from supplier dispatch to field arrival.

Beyond delivery, Polaris also supports installation, commissioning, and after-sales interfaces. This helps clients maintain communication with suppliers and contractors after the equipment reaches site, especially when technical clarification, spare parts, or service coordination is required.

By combining technical requirement definition, supplier engagement, documentation management, logistics coordination, and field support, Polaris provides a practical service model for oilfield projects that require strong execution discipline from planning through operation.
